Battery life Most robot vacuums and mop use lithium ion batteries, which can be charged using a standard wall-charger. The docking station can also be an ideal way to keep dirty water tanks and a cleaning pads. Some have a self-emptying feature, meaning you don't have to empty the bin at the middle. Apps that monitor the development of your robot mop as well as its cleaning history are another important feature. A lot of apps let you identify rooms, mark off areas, and set up an alert to notify you when your robot requires maintenance. Some even have smart mapping, which allows the robot to create a detailed map of your floorplan while it goes and then remembers the arrangement from one cleaning job to the next. Cost A robot vacuum with mop is a great way to save time and effort. The most effective models can even remove scuffs and stains to make your floors appear like new. You will have to spend lots of money to purchase a high-quality model. You can buy an ordinary floor sweeping machine for less than $300. A mapping automatic emptying robot costs $400 to $600. You can also purchase a mop and vacuum combination for around $1000. The more features you require, the higher the price will be.
